I just installed the G2.0, and tried to create a new user through the admin panel, however, I found that if I log in as the new user, i do not have the function to upload any photos.

Meaning that only the admin has the permission to upload photos to the gallery.

So, how can I create a new user and allow this user to upload photos?

since G2 is designed to mainly manage photos in albums, but also is general enough to manage any type of files, we called the actions / permissions "add item" and "add album". well, we could have called album a "container" to confuse even more.
we should it make simpler to change the string "sub-item" or "item" to "photo", true.
right now, you could write your own G2 translation, english to english and replace "item" with photos...

but we are aware of major usability issues that G2 still has. and we want to address them in the next release of G2. but we still lack of a usability expert (but we know where we can find some in the open source community).
